We have established a method for selecting A-type supergiants from the LAMOST data by using the spectral index,and we have successfully identified 121 A-type supergiants(includes 54 star spectra of luminosity type I,33 star spectra of luminosity type I-II,and 34 star spectra of luminosity type II).First,we select a larger A-type star candidate from the spatial distribution of the line index as a research sample,and then further select a A-type supergiant candidate sample from the A-type star candidate sample through the line index condition.This candidate sample has 45357 spectras.Then we further screened these stars by the spectral characteristics of A-type supergiants and human eyes,and finally obtained 121 A-type supergiants spectra(111 stars).A multi-faceted analysis of the A-type supergiant samples revealed that the number of stars of the A4-A7 in the A-type supergiant samples was relatively small.In order to check the reliability of the samples,we used the software package MKCLASS to perform template matching on the A-type supergiant samples,and found that the MKCLASS template matching can give more reliable classification results in general,but some star spectra were severely misclassified,and some did not give the results of the classification.In addition,by studying the spatial distribution of the samples,we also found that most of the A-type supergiants are distributed on the galactic disk,but 10 of them are distributed in the high galactic latitude area(glat>20° or glat<-20°).We will perform further high-resolution spectroscopy observations and analysis on them.
